The SafeEndo ReCreate LC-5 Composite Kit is a comprehensive solution for dental professionals seeking optimal results in restorative and cosmetic dentistry. This universal light-curing nano-hybrid composite kit offers a versatile range of shades, including A1, A2, A3, and B2, ensuring seamless integration with natural tooth color variations. Each pack contains 4.5g syringes for convenient and precise application.
The kit includes Smart Etch, a 5ml etching solution that enhances bonding effectiveness, and ReCreate Bond-5, a reliable adhesive for durable restoration. Accessories are thoughtfully included for a streamlined application process. The product, identified by the reference number 005-05-445, further allows customization of shades upon request, catering to individual patient needs.
Indicated for a variety of dental procedures, including the restoration of all cavity classes based on Black's classification, core build-ups, splinting, correction of composite restorations, and fabrication of indirect restorations such as inlays, onlays, and veneers, this kit is a versatile solution for diverse clinical scenarios.
The advantages of SafeEndo ReCreate LC-5 Composite Kit are manifold. It exhibits excellent polishing properties, ensuring a smooth and aesthetically pleasing finish. The material does not adhere to instruments, promoting efficient handling during application. Its stability at the modeling stage facilitates precise shaping, and the composite's excellent radiopacity ensures accurate diagnostics. Additionally, the inclusion of fluorescence adds a natural look to the restorations. Direction to use
Direction to use
Shade Selection:
- Choose the appropriate composite shade (A1, A2, A3, B2) based on the patient's natural tooth color.
Preparation:
- Ensure the tooth surface is clean and dry.
- If required, etch the enamel with Smart Etch for 15-30 seconds, rinse, and dry.
Bonding Application:
- Apply ReCreate Bond-5 to the etched or prepared tooth surface according to the manufacturer's instructions.
- Light-cure the bonding agent as directed.
Composite Placement:
- Dispense the desired composite shade onto a mixing pad.
- Use appropriate instruments for precise application.
- Sculpt and shape the composite to achieve the desired restoration.
Light Curing:
- Light-cure the composite material using a suitable curing light according to recommended time guidelines.
Finishing and Polishing:
- Once cured, contour and polish the restoration to achieve the desired aesthetics.
- Utilize appropriate finishing instruments for optimal results.

Question: What’s the difference between SafeEndo ReCreate LC-5 Composite Kit and SafeEndo ReCreate LC-7 Composite Kit ?
Answer: The main difference between the SafeEndo ReCreate LC-5 Composite Kit and the SafeEndo ReCreate LC-7 Composite Kit lies in their bonding agents and additional components. The LC-7 includes a 7th generation bonding agent and ProClean 8gm Composite Polishing Paste, while the LC-5 features a 5th generation bonding agent and Smart Etch 5ml, and both kits have same composite syringes.
